Loan Repayment & Financial Support – NHSC

Tampa Family Health Centers is an NHSC approved site, making this position eligible for the National Health Service Corps Loan Repayment Program.

Qualifying Women’s Health Nurse Practitioners may receive:

Up to $75,000 in student loan repayment for an initial two-year full-time service commitment

Additional loan repayment opportunities for extended service commitments

NHSC loan repayment is in addition to base salary, productivity incentives, and TFHC benefits, making this role a strong long-term financial opportunity.
